csv是一种通用的文件格式,它能被导入各种PC表格及数据库中。csv文件里的一行即为数据表的一行。生成的数据表字段会自动用半角逗号隔开。csv文件可用记事本和excel打开,用记事本打开时会显示逗号,用excel打开时没有逗号,逗号是用来分列的,同时还可用Editplus打开。 将本地csv文件复制到pycharm,首次打开非.py文件时需要选择格式:举例说明,打开方式选错出现乱码的情况
Python CSV Toolkit整理了一些个人在利用python处理csv文件时经常用到的一些自定义方法,放在这里主要方便自己查阅,也可以给其他人做参考目录输出CSV文件某列的匹配/不匹配的记录调整csv文件的列的顺序CSV转换器抽取特定列除去完全重复的记录根据列名排序键值互换输出CSV文件某列的匹配/不匹配的记录主要用于从csv文件中抽取出匹配特定列的特定字段集合的记录,比如现有这么一个cs
转载 2024-08-14 11:24:53
49阅读
# 解决Javacsv中文乱码问题 在Java中处理csv文件时,经常会遇到中文乱码的问题。这种问题通常是由于编码不一致导致的,所以我们需要在处理csv文件时正确设置编码,以避免中文乱码的情况发生。下面我们将介绍如何在Java中处理csv文件时避免中文乱码问题。 ## 1. 创建csv文件并写入中文数据 首先,我们需要创建一个csv文件,并写入一些包含中文字符的数据。可以使用Java的CS
原创 2024-06-19 06:46:51
41阅读
# 解决JavaCSV中文乱码问题 在使用JavaCSV文件时,经常会遇到中文乱码的问题。这是因为CSV文件默认使用的是ASCII编码,而中文字符通常采用UTF-8编码。为了解决这个问题,我们需要在写入CSV文件时指定编码格式为UTF-8。 ## CSV文件 CSV(Comma-Separated Values)是一种常见的文本文件格式,用于存储表格数据。每行代表一条记录,每列用逗号分隔
原创 2024-04-08 05:52:27
117阅读
ExcellentExport.js的方法,利用base64下载文件。支持chrome ,opera,firefox. 于是决定拿来为我所用!说明一下,这个js的好处是:一句js脚本,就能前台下载,完全无须后台。但外国人不了解中文csv用excel打开直接乱码。 但用记事本打开,再直接保存,或另存为ansi都可以让中文不乱码。js里默认应该是utf-8,昨天试了用utf-8转gb2312,失败了
今天,我们将学习csv文件的基本操作。 什么是csv文件? CSV是Comma-Separated Value的缩写,意思是逗号分隔值,其文件以文本形式存储表格数据。1.创建示例csv文件首先,在目录下创建一个名为test.csv的文件,用记事本打开,输入:A,B,C,D 1,2,3,4 5,6,7,8这里说明一下,第一行充当CSV文件的标题,第二,三行充当每个列表项,如果用Excel表格打开,会
转载 2023-06-21 00:52:07
191阅读
PythonPython开发Python语言Python中通过csv的writerow输出的内容有多余的空行两种方法 第一种方法如下生成的csv文件会有多个空行import csv #python2可以用file替代open with open("test.csv","w") as csvfile: writer = csv.writer(csvfile) #先写入columns_name wri
转载 2023-06-26 00:13:59
224阅读
先说下编码相关的知识。编码方式有很多种:ASCII, GBK UTF-8等。ASCII 码主要是规范英语字符和二进制位之间的关系。英语词汇组成简单,由 26 个字母构成。使用一个字节就能表示一个字母符号。外加各种符号,使用 128 个字符就满足编码要求。汉字的数量大约将近 10 万个,日常所使用的汉字有 3000 个。显然,ASCII 编码无法满足需求。所以汉字采用 GBK 编码,使用两个字节表示
转载 2023-08-23 18:02:52
384阅读
# 使用Python处理中文CSV文件 在数据处理的领域中,CSV(Comma-Separated Values)文件是一种非常常见的数据格式,它以逗号分隔值来存储表格数据。Python是一种功能强大的编程语言,提供了许多库和工具来处理CSV文件,包括中文CSV文件。在本篇文章中,我们将介绍如何使用Python处理中文CSV文件,并给出相应的代码示例。 ## 安装依赖库 要处理中文CSV文件
原创 2024-03-07 06:02:08
73阅读
python3 库pandas写入csv格式文件出现中文乱码问题解决方法解决方案:问题是使用pandas的DataFrame的to_csv方法实现csv文件输出,但是遇到中文乱码问题,已验证的正确的方法是:df.to_csv("cnn_predict_result.csv")更改为:df.to_csv("cnn_predict_result.csv",encoding="utf_8_sig")核心
# Python JSON的中文内容CSV后乱码 ## 引言 在Python编程中,我们经常需要处理JSON数据。JSON(JavaScript Object Notation)是一种常用的数据交换格式,它使用简洁的文本表示结构化数据,广泛应用于互联网应用中。而CSV(Comma-Separated Values)则是一种常用的表格数据存储格式,它使用逗号分隔不同的字段,适用于大多数电子表格
原创 2023-12-19 06:58:05
345阅读
python——CSV文件的读取,写入和追加1.CSV文件的读取:例: import csv #导入CSV文件(CSV文件和PY文件必须在同一个包下) def read_csv(path): #定义一个叫read_csv的函数,这个函数的内容是: file=open(path,'r
转载 2023-06-26 00:09:26
122阅读
参考大佬文章Pythoncsv文件的读写操作,感谢!代码整理如下:# coding=utf-8 import csv """ csv文件的、读操作 """ # -- 写入csv -- # 方式1(相对简洁) # 如果为Python3.0需要在open()加入关键参数newline='',否则CSV文件将有两倍行距。 with open('file1.csv', 'w', newline='
转载 2023-07-02 17:40:10
198阅读
csv文件与txt文件类似,区别点就是在csv文件中,字段间使用“,”或“|”隔开,达到类似与表格的效果。csv文件可以使用记事本打开(打开可见分隔符“,”),也可使用excel打开(打开以表格形式显示,看不见分隔符)。注意:尽量不要使用wps打开,可能会打乱格式。#在操作csv文件时,需要导入csv库,csvpython内置库,无需下载 import csv #读取csv文件内容#在操作csv
转载 2023-06-14 22:07:25
79阅读
默认在open(‘data.csv’,'w+')模式下会有空行。在open后面添加newline=‘’ 即可解决。https://stackoverflow.com/questions/41045510/pandas-read-csv-ignore-rows-after-a-blank-linewith open("data_a.csv","w",newline='') as csvfile:
转载 2023-06-21 15:17:31
562阅读
       很多情况下,大家可能会遇到相同情况,就是现在有一些数据需要保存在某个文件里面,但是后续会不断更新添加新的数据,例如在爬虫的时候,一页一页爬取数据的时候,当然可以将所有页数据先合并到一起,再保存起来,但是也可以通过下文这种方式,输出一页的数据就保存一次,好像有点麻烦哈,但是如果是其他情况的话,可能就会便捷一点,例如数据更新不是很快这种情况等等。1
转载 2023-06-26 11:16:48
1488阅读
# Python导出CSV文件中文数据的实现方法 ## 1. 概述 在Python中,我们可以使用pandas库来将数据导出为CSV文件。而对于含有中文字符的数据,我们需要在导出的过程中进行一些特殊处理,以确保中文字符能够正确地显示在CSV文件中。 本文将向你介绍如何使用Python的pandas库将中文数据导出为CSV文件的步骤,并提供每一步所需的代码和注释。 ## 2. 导出CSV文件的
原创 2023-09-23 00:21:17
247阅读
# Python写入CSV文件中文数据 ## 1. 概述 在Python中,我们可以使用csv模块将数据写入CSV文件。CSV(Comma Separated Values)是一种常见的文件格式,通常用于存储表格数据。本文将教你如何使用Python中文数据写入CSV文件。 ## 2. 实现步骤 以下是实现这个任务的步骤,我们可以用表格展示出来: | 步骤 | 描述 | | --- | -
原创 2023-12-10 06:41:09
120阅读
# Python读取CSV中文教程 ## 流程图 ```mermaid flowchart TD A[准备CSV文件] --> B[导入pandas库] B --> C[读取CSV文件] C --> D[处理中文数据] D --> E[输出结果] ``` ## 类图 ```mermaid classDiagram class Pandas {
原创 2024-07-10 06:06:02
34阅读
### 如何用Python读取中文CSV文件 作为一名经验丰富的开发者,你需要教会一位刚入行的小白如何实现“python读取中文csv”这个任务。下面我将为你详细介绍整个流程,并提供每个步骤所需的代码和说明。 #### 流程图: ```mermaid erDiagram CUSTOMER ||--o| ORDERS : has ORDERS ||--|{ ORDER_DETA
原创 2024-03-22 03:40:01
56阅读
  • 1
  • 2
  • 3
  • 4
  • 5